This review is from: Kenny Drew Trio (Audio CD)
This is a pretty enjoyable bop oriented set from the Kenny Drew Trio which consists of Kenny on Piano, Paul Chambers on bass, and Philly Joe Jones on drums. Chambers and Philly Joe work well together as usual and Kenny seems inspired by their fire. The high points of the album are Drew's interpretation of the classic Ellington Tune "Caravan" and Drew's composition Wierd-o. Drews playing on both is fantastic and Chambers offers a nice bowed solo on wierd-o. Not exactly an essential recording to have, but one that fans of Drew or the consistently amazing Chambers/Jones duo may want to check out.
